Christmas is still 95 days away, but for some, it's already on their minds, with thousands of people already snapping up various shopping deals and offers. Last week, reports emerged that Tesco was flogging Christmas chocolate tubs for a mere £2.95 instead of £7 with a Clubcard in selected stores.
Asda has also slashed the price of Celebrations, Quality Street, Cadbury Heroes, and Cadbury Roses weeks ahead of December 25 for those who wish to stock up early. Starting from £4.45, all tubs are among the cheapest on the market right now, and you don't need to use a loyalty card either.
Besides supermarkets, one particular store that is a popular choice for millions across the country for selling a vast array of affordable items under one roof has joined in on the action. B&M has also reduced the price of its Christmas chocolates, with one pack getting a 26% reduction.

Cadbury fans will be chuffed to know that B&M has lowered the price of Cadbury's Christmas Selection Pack (78g) to £1.29 - it was £1.75 - saving customers nearly 50p. Inside the pack, shoppers can enjoy five classic Cadbury fan favourites, including Curly Wurly, Chomp, Freddo, Fudge, and Buttons.
Each pack contains five chocolates and costs £1.29, which is about 26p per chocolate. The inexpensive prices mean Brits can save more money to spend on other Christmas presents, food, and decorations this year, reports the Manchester Evening News.
Meanwhile at B&M, shoppers can snap up a Cadbury Stocking Selection Box for £3.50. This "unique stocking-shaped" Christmas selection box is packed with "delicious" Cadbury chocolates, B&M says.
The retailer adds: "Featuring six of your favourite treats over the festive period." The box contains a Wispa, Boost, Twirl, Crunchie, Dairy Milk and one Dairy Milk Caramel.
Additional choices at B&M include this Celebrations Centrepiece Gift Box 385g, which is priced at £5.50 - a cost that undercuts both Tesco and Sainsbury's.
Another Christmas stocking filler that has been slashed at B&M is this Quality Street Favourites Golden Selection Pouch 283g. It was £4, but has been sliced by 25% to £3. At Sainsbury's, customers can purchase the same pouch for £4.75, or £4.25 at Iceland, making B&M's offer amongst the most budget-friendly available.
